Gyeongnam Bank, Zero Pay Payback Event... Up to 15% Discount Benefits
[Asia Economy Reporter Kim Min-young] BNK Gyeongnam Bank announced on the 22nd that it is conducting a Zero Pay payback event together with Gyeongsangnam-do.
Zero Pay users who make Zero Pay (including gift certificates) payments by the end of next month will receive a 5% payback on the payment amount, up to a maximum of 50,000 KRW per month. In addition, Zero Pay gift certificates in the Gyeongnam area can be purchased at a discount of up to 10%.
Incentive benefits are provided to affiliated stores. Zero Pay affiliated stores will receive payment amount incentives until the end of September. The target is stores with monthly Zero Pay payments of 20,000 KRW or more. Stores with annual sales of 800 million KRW or less will receive 5%, and other stores will receive 2%, with incentives paid up to a maximum of 300,000 KRW per month.

A Gyeongnam Bank official said, “Participating in this event is good for Gyeongnam residents who use Zero Pay as it helps reduce household expenses, and it is good for small business owners as it can increase sales revenue,” adding, “However, since the discount rates and limits vary for gift certificates issued by each local government in the Gyeongnam area, please be careful when purchasing.”
